A vulnerability was found in Mozilla Firefox 1.0.6 (Web Browser). It has been rated as problematic. Affected by this issue is some unknown functionality of the component String Handler. Impacted is integrity. CVE summarizes:

Mozilla Thunderbird 1.0 and Firefox 1.0.6 allows remote attackers to obfuscate URIs via a long URI, which causes the address bar to go blank and could facilitate phishing attacks.

The bug was discovered 08/09/2005. The weakness was disclosed 08/08/2005 by Marc Ruef with scip AG as not defined mailinglist post (Website). The advisory is available at computec.ch. The vendor was not involved in the coordination of the public release. This vulnerability is handled as CVE-2005-2602 since 08/17/2005. The attack may be launched remotely. No form of authentication is required for exploitation. Successful exploitation requires user interaction by the victim. Technical details are unknown but a public exploit is available.

A public exploit has been developed by Marc Ruef and been published immediately after the advisory. The exploit is available at computec.ch. It is declared as proof-of-concept. As 0-day the estimated underground price was around $25k-$100k.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 19718 (Mozilla Browser < 1.7.12 Multiple Vulnerabilities),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family Windows and running in the context l.

The problem might be mitigated by replacing the product with Google Chrome, Opera, Apple Safari or Microsoft Internet Explorer as an alternative. A possible mitigation has been published 2 months after the disclosure of the vulnerability.

The vulnerability is also documented in the databases at X-Force (21754) and Tenable (19718). The entry 1683 is pretty similar.
